
Battalion edge Rangers 4-3
September 6, 2010 - Ontario Hockey League (OHL)
Kitchener Rangers News Release
The Kitchener Rangers traveled to Brampton today to close out a preseason series with the Battalion.
The Rangers scored the only goal of the first period when Tobias Rieder deflected a point shot from Evan McEneny at 10:03. The Rangers held a 13-7 advantage in shots.
Sean Jones tied the score at 1-1 when he converted a cross ice pass to beat Brandon Maxwell at 1:48 of the second period.
Jones made it 2-1 with the Battalion on a two man-advantage after Charlie Dodero and Branden Morris both picked up back-to-back delay of game penalties.
The Battalion scored their second power play goal of the game only moments later to jump into a 3-1 lead when Maxwell was beat to the short side.
Sean Jones scored his 3rd goal of the game while the Battalion were enjoying their 2nd two man advantage of the period. Jones beat Maxwell from the side of the net.
Jason Akeson answered back for the Rangers at the 55-second mark of the 3rd period when he received a pass from Ryan Murphy and drilled a wrist shot high under the crossbar.
Zach Lorentz scored his 3rd goal in three games at 5:06 to make the score 4-3.
Lorentz had just moments earlier hit the crossbar before picking up a rebound off a Dodero point shot and snapping home the Rangers third goal of the game.
The Rangers Exhibition record now sits at 1-1-1 with two games remaining against the Niagara Ice dogs.
Jeff Skinner, Cody Sol, Jeremy Morin, Jesse Young, Jonathan Jasper, Andrew Crescenzi and Matt Tipoff did not dress for the Rangers. The Rangers return home on Friday, September 17th to face the Niagara IceDogs at 7:30pm.
